Your Role
As a Gensler Accounting Manager, you will be responsible for supervising the Europe regional Accounts Payable function and assist the Regional Finance Director with cash management, budgets and P&L. Your success lies in being highly organised, data-driven, and passionate about delivering a high degree of customer service to meet the needs of internal customers and business partners. You will work with a team of collaborative colleagues as well as partner with the Regional Finance Director to analyse financial information and optimise planning and performance.
What You Will Do
- Supervise Accounts Payable to support efficient workflows and monitor employee expenses, travel and credit card statements for the Europe region
- Check and approve payment runs, ensuring a timely and accurate service
- Conduct monthly reviews of fixed asset registers
- Assist the Regional Finance Director with cash management and update weekly cash projections
- Support month end tasks and the preparation of P&L across multiple currencies and entities
- Review costs for variances and produce costs accruals
- Collate all necessary information for National Statistics reporting
- Work with the Regional Finance Director to monitor spending and create budgets
- Review the monthly set of balance sheets, raising queries where necessary. Collaborate with the Finance team to clear the reconciling items
- Perform an annual audit and respond to related questions
